Photo Caption:

While stationed at South Bass Island Lighthouse, Anna and keeper Paul Prochnow kept a large garden and canned and froze much of what they grew. They also kept chickens for fresh eggs and poultry. Other staples had to be obtained from the mainland or the small general store on the island. (U.S. Coast Guard photo courtesy Ohio Sea Grant.)
